  • Supply Chain Operational Performance and Its Influential Factors: Cross National Analysis

    Korrakot Yaibuathet, Takao Enkawa, Sadami Suzuki

    Jounal of Japan Industrial Management Association   57 ( 6 )   473 - 482   2007

     More details

    Language:English   Publisher:Japan Industrial Management Association  

    This research paper aims to investigate operational performance and potential factors that constitute efficient supply chain operational performance in different countries, namely, Japan, Thailand and China. By analyzing the supply chain performance, the supply chain management (SCM) logistics scorecard (LSC) has been utilized as a self-evaluation tool for participating companies in the above-mentioned countries. The LSC focused on four decisive areas, namely, company strategy, planning and execution capability, logistics performance, and IT utilization. The number of participating companies from each country was 205 from Japan, 105 from Thailand and 107 from China. The scores in each assessment area were compared among countries. Subsequently, in this research study, a factor analysis was conducted using the result of the LSC in order to identify significant factors that represent the operational performance of SCM in each country. The results of the factor analysis indicate that the structures for generating successful SCM in Japanese, Thai and Chinese industries are not the same due to different operating environments.

  • Introduction of Equalized Lot Size Concept in TOC Scheduling

    GORDILLO G., Suzuki Sadami, Enkawa Takao

    Journal of Japan Industrial Management Association   56 ( 4 )   237 - 245   2005

     More details

    Language:English   Publisher:Japan Industrial Management Association  

    The proposal of the Equalized Lot Size Value Algorithm is introduced as an alternative to generate a better total makespan of a production system and, at the same time, pursuing the smoothing of the machine loading when a high demand fluctuation occurs. The ELSV algorithm combines the merits of the Equalized and Synchronized Production (ESP) and Theory of Constraints (TOC), in order to obtain a concrete definition of ESP algorithm and a smaller makespan for the Job Shop problems under TOC scheduling. As a result, smaller equalized lot sizes can improve makespan, especially for larger systems. On the other hand, equalized lot sizes also provide enough improvement in the smoothing of loading, even though it is a half of original size.

  • Developing the SCM Logistics Scorecard and Analyzing its Relation to the Managerial Performance

    ARASHIDA Kouta, ENKAWA Takao, HAMASAKI Akihiro, SUZUKI Sadami

    Journal of Japan Industrial Management Association   55 ( 2 )   95 - 103   2004

     More details

    Language:Japanese   Publisher:Japan Industrial Management Association  

    Recently, interest in logistics and supply chain management has grown explosively through exposure to fierce competition and changing circumstances. This interest has led many companies to build their supply chain. In most cases, however, organizational constraints impede their formation of supply chain management (SCM). To breakthrough these constraints, various kinds of scorecards have been developed. A scorecard is a simplified benchmark methodology to diagnose and evaluate various advantages and disadvantages of business operations, such as IT utilization, etc. from the point of total optimization of SCM. In this study, we propose and develop the general-purpose scorecard named the SCM logistics scorecard (LSC) after conducting survey research on various scorecards, and verify its validity and effectiveness. To do this, we gather actual data based on LSC from many manufacturing companies and extract five factors, which represent the drivers of managerial performance through these data. Using the corresponding companies' financial bottom line indexes, we analyze the correlation between these indexes and our factors. The result shows that higher scores of LSC, which leads to higher scores in the five factors, bring significantly positive financial outcomes. At the same time, we also verify statistically that IT itself is just an enabler or means in building SCM by introducing a causal-effect model among these factors leading to managerial performances.

  • Extended TOC Scheduling and Its Effectiveness

    SUZUKI Sadami, ENKAWA Takao

    Journal of Japan Industrial Management Association   52 ( 3 )   163 - 171   2001

     More details

    Language:Japanese   Publisher:Japan Industrial Management Association  

    This study considers the effectiveness of TOC scheduling by developing an extended algorithm so as to be applicable even in a job shop environment. TOC originated from a scheduling technique named Drum-Buffer-Rope (DBR). The DBR technique is based on following steps. (1) Identify the primary bottleneck resource, (2) Exploit the bottleneck by scheduling it first, (3) Subordinate scheduling of all other resources to that of bottleneck resource. TOC scheduling seems appropriate for flow shop environments, and has been shown to be quite effective in such kind of production system. But as production systems become more complicated, like a job shop, it becomes increasingly difficult to identify a single resource as a constraint. A few past studies have speculated on the effectiveness of DBR in non-flow shop environments, but none has attempted to analyze its actual use and application range. In order to investigate the application range of the TOC scheduling technique, an extended TOC scheduling technique is proposed, and a criterion, Fd, is defined to classify several kinds of production systems. The extended algorithm is then compared to Tabu search, which is one of the most promising meta-heuristics for considering the critical path as a system constraint. The results show the application range of extended DBR algorithm which considers a single resource as the constraint and suggest that outside this range it is more appropriate to consider the critical path as the constraint.
